Setting Up Your Saving Envelopes
Now that you have your saving envelopes, it’s time to set them up. Here’s a step-by-step guide:
- Label Each Envelope: Assign a specific category to each envelope, such as groceries, entertainment, bills, etc.
- Allocate a Budget: Determine the amount of money you want to save for each category. This can be based on your monthly expenses or financial goals.
- Start Saving: Begin depositing money into each envelope according to your budget. Make sure to keep track of the amount you save in each envelope.
By following these steps, you’ll have a clear and organized system for saving money.
Creating a Budget
A well-planned budget is crucial for making the most out of your saving envelopes. Here’s how to create a budget:
- Track Your Expenses: Keep a record of all your expenses for a month. This includes bills, groceries, entertainment, and other necessities.
- Calculate Your Income: Determine your monthly income, including your salary, bonuses, and any other sources of income.
- Allocate Funds to Each Category: Divide your income among different categories based on your expenses and financial goals.
- Adjust Your Budget: Review your budget regularly and make adjustments as needed to ensure you stay on track.
By creating a budget, you’ll have a clear idea of how much money you can allocate to each saving envelope.

Using Saving Envelopes for Emergency Funds
One of the primary reasons for using saving envelopes is to build an emergency fund. Here’s how to do it:
- Set a Goal: Determine how much money you need for an emergency fund. A common rule of thumb is to have three to six months’ worth of living expenses.
- Allocate a Percentage: Decide how much of your income you’ll allocate to your emergency fund each month.
- Deposit Regularly: Consistently deposit money into your emergency fund envelope until you reach your goal.
By having an emergency fund, you’ll be prepared for unexpected expenses and avoid falling into debt.
